(see options) The NEC gives you the choice of four methods for ensuring electrical continuity at service equipment service raceways, and service conductor enclosures[25092(B):.. L Banding jumpers. Bond metal parts to the service neutrat conductor. This requites a main bonding jumper [250,24(B) and 250,781. because the service nautrai conductor provides the effective ground- fault current path to the power supply 3 [250.24(C)], You don't have to install an equipment grounding conductor within PVC conduit containing service -entrance conductors 1250.142(A)(1) and 352.60 Ex 2I` h 2. Threaded fittings. Terminate metal raceways to metal enclosures by threaded hubs on enclosures (if made wrench tight). 3. Threadless fittings, Terminate metal raceways to metal enclosures by threadless fittings (if made tight) 4. Other listed devices.
